What is a rotating equipment engineer?

Rotating Equipment Engineers are specialized engineers who focus on the design, maintenance, operation, and troubleshooting of machinery with moving parts, such as pumps, compressors, turbines, and engines. They play a crucial role in ensuring the reliability and efficiency of rotating equipment in industries like oil and gas, power generation, and manufacturing. Working remotely, they may use digital monitoring tools, analyze performance data, and coordinate with onsite teams to solve technical challenges and optimize equipment performance.

What are some typical challenges faced by rotating equipment engineers working remotely, and how can they be addressed?

Rotating Equipment Engineers working remotely often face challenges such as limited on-site access to machinery, difficulty in coordinating real-time troubleshooting, and ensuring clear communication with plant personnel. These challenges can be addressed by leveraging remote monitoring tools, maintaining regular virtual meetings with site teams, and using detailed documentation and digital twin technology to analyze equipment performance. Building strong relationships with on-site staff and establishing clear communication protocols are also key to effective remote collaboration and problem-solving.

Job description


As an Advanced Field Service Engineer - Turbo Machinery - Rotating Equipment / Controls (Sundyne Products) here at Honeywell, you will play a critical role in delivering expert technical service and support for Sundyne rotating equipment and control systems. You will engage directly with customers to ensure optimal operation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of complex rotating machinery and control solutions, enhancing reliability and performance in demanding industrial environments.
You will report directly to our Field Service Supervisor, and you'll work Remote.
In this role, you will impact the operational efficiency and safety of our customers by ensuring their rotating equipment and control systems function at peak performance, minimizing downtime and maximizing productivity in critical applications.

Responsibilities
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Provide advanced technical support, maintenance, and repair services for Sundyne rotating equipment and control systems at customer sites.
  • Troubleshoot and resolve complex issues related to rotating machinery, including pumps, compressors, and associated control hardware and software.
  • Collaborate with engineering and product teams to implement solutions that meet customer requirements and comply with industry standards.
  • Conduct detailed training sessions for customers and internal teams on equipment operation, maintenance, and safety protocols.
  • Ensure strict adherence to company policies, safety standards, and regulatory requirements during all field service activities.
  • Domestic and international travel of up to 60% is required.

Qualifications
YOU MUST HAVE
  • Bachelor's degree from an accredited institution in a technical discipline such as science, technology, engineering, or mathematics.
  • Minimum of 6+ years of proven field service engineering experience, including at least 4+ years focused on rotating equipment and control systems (e.g., pumps, compressors, turbines), preferably Sundyne products.
  • Strong technical expertise in rotating machinery, with hands-on experience supporting 100+ field service interventions involving troubleshooting, repair, and commissioning activities.
  • Proficiency with control systems hardware and software related to rotating equipment, including diagnostics, calibration tools, PLC/HMI troubleshooting, and VFD systems with 3+ years of applied use.
  • Knowledge of industry standards and safety regulations (API, OSHA, ISO) with 100% compliance experience in field service operations and safety-critical environments.

WE VALUE
  • Advanced degree in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or related technical field.
  • 3+ years of experience working in industrial sectors such as oil and gas, chemical processing, or power generation, supporting large-scale rotating equipment systems.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ills demonstrated through participation in 10+ root cause failure analyses (RCFA) or structured troubleshooting events.
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ively in dynamic field environments, successfully managing 3-5 concurrent field assignments or projects.
  • Familiarity with digital diagnostic tools and software platforms used in rotating equipment maintenance and control systems, with 2+ years of hands-on use in predictive maintenance or condition monitoring systems.
